Skip to main content

Home/ MaRS/ Group items tagged visibli

Rss Feed Group items tagged

Cathy Bogaart

IDC Canada Profiles Ten Digital Media Companies to Watch - IDC, Jan 20, 2011 - 0 views

  •  
    A new IDC report, "Ten Canadian Digital Media Companies To Watch: Toronto," profiles ten promising digital media start-ups based in Toronto. Seven of the ten are MaRS clients! BitStrips, InGamer, Nulayer, PushLife, Shiny Ads, Verold and Visibli are among the companies featured as "innovating and excelling" in the digital media sector in Toronto.
Tim T

iPhone Dev Center: iPhone Human Interface Guidelines: Human Interface Principles: Creat... - 0 views

  • A great user interface follows human interface design principles that are based on the way people—users—think and work, not on the capabilities of the device
  • a beautiful, intuitive, compelling user interface enhances an application’s functionality and inspires a positive emotional attachment in users.
  • model your application’s objects and actions on objects and actions in the real world.
  • ...10 more annotations...
  • This technique especially helps novice users quickly grasp how your application works. Folders are a classic software metaphor. People file things in folders in the real world, so they immediately understand the idea of putting data into folders on a computer.
  • iPhone OS users enjoy a heightened sense of direct manipulation because of the Multi-Touch interface. Using gestures, people feel a greater affinity for, and sense of control over, the objects they see on screen, because they do not use any intermediate device (such as a mouse) to manipulate them.
  • An iPhone application is better than a person at remembering lists of options, commands, data, and so on. Take advantage of this by presenting choices or options in list form, so users can easily scan them and make a choice. Keeping text input to a minimum frees users from having to spend a lot of time typing and frees your application from having to perform a lot of error checking. Presenting choices to the user, instead of asking for more open-ended input, also allows them to concentrate on accomplishing tasks with your application, instead of remembering how to operate it.
  • Your application should respond to every user action with some visible change.
  • Keep actions simple and straightforward so users can easily understand and remember them
  • Whenever possible, use standard controls and behaviors that users are already familiar with.
  • appearance has a strong impact on functionality: An application that appears cluttered or illogical is hard to understand and use.
  • Aesthetic integrity is not a measure of how beautiful your application is. It’s a measure of how well the appearance of your application integrates with its function. For example, a productivity application should keep decorative elements subtle and in the background, while giving prominence to the task by providing standard controls and behaviors.
  • An immersive application is at the other end of the spectrum, and users expect a beautiful appearance that promises fun and encourages discovery.
  • appearance still needs to integrate with the task.
1 - 2 of 2
Showing 20 items per page